The DFV German family Versicherung AG is a German corporation of the insurance industry based in Frankfurt am Main . The shares have been traded in the Prime Standard on the Frankfurt Stock Exchange since December 4, 2018 .

Companies

The company has been in business since April 1, 2007. In terms of sales , the company is organized as a direct insurance company and offers products in the field of property insurance , liability and accident insurance throughout Germany. In addition to these, health insurance and life insurance or pension products are sold. Distribution channels for the products are, in addition to direct sales via the Internet and telephone, broker sales and sales via multiple agents. Due to the high proportional business share in the health insurance segment, the rating agency Assekurata classified DFV as a non-substitutive health insurer in its rating of July 31, 2013, i.e. as a private health insurer that does not offer services as a substitute for statutory insurance.

Since December 17, 2012, DFV has been selling additional insurance under the KKH Meinplus brand via the commercial health insurance company - KKH .

IPO 2018

An IPO in the Prime Standard on the Frankfurt Stock Exchange was planned for November 14, 2018 . However, due to the market environment, a placement at a share price of 27 to 23 euros was not possible. Therefore, the IPO took place three weeks later with a reduced issue price of 12 euros, but the volume was increased to 4.37 million shares. The company's income from the IPO was 52 million euros (instead of 79 million euros as originally planned). The previous shareholders hold their shares in connection with the IPO. The income from the newly issued shares will flow into advertising and sales.

At the time of going public, the company had a portfolio of 420,000 policies. At the end of the first half of 2020, the company was managing 535,830 insurance contracts, of which over 100,000 were concluded in the 2019 financial year alone. The inventory contributions as of June 30, 2020 amounted to 114.3 million euros.
